Comedian Oliver Pocher is embarking on a weight loss journey, opting for a weight loss injection under medical supervision. His personal talk show "Hey Olli" in "Pocher Club", as reported by "Bild", discussed his new health regimen, including possible side effects and costs estimated around 360 euros per month.
In his quest to shed pounds, Pocher is not only relying on the injection, but also modifying his diet, quitting energy drinks, and engaging in more physical activity. In an interview, he stated his intention to stop using the injection soon and maintain his weight loss organically.
Celebrity Weight Loss Injections: A Growing Trend
Numerous celebrities have spoken about these injections to achieve weight loss. For instance, German footballer and former "Promi Big Brother" contestant Max Kruse revealed his plan to shed 10 to 15 kilos via fat-burning injections. Singer Robbie Williams also managed to reduce weight using medication like Ozempic.
It's important to be aware that these substances may have side effects, such as nausea, low blood sugar, dehydration, or, in rare cases, allergic reactions and acute pancreatitis.

- Rapid weight loss: Famous individuals, such as Golnesa "GG" Gharachedaghi from Bravo’s Shahs of Sunset, have dropped weight significantly using semaglutide shots.
- Adjusted doses: Users like GG often reduce doses over time for maintenance (e.g., from ~2 mg to 1 mg for Ozempic).
- Clinical results: Novel drugs like orforglipron, a daily GLP-1 pill, have demonstrated weight loss of up to 7.9% of body weight in 40 weeks, comparable to injectables like Ozempic and Mounjaro.
- Creeping side effects: Examples of side effects include the so-called "Ozempic face," characterized by facial volume loss leading to an aged appearance, as well as gastrointestinal issues like n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, and constipation.
